首页主机资讯jdk命令 使用技巧

jdk命令 使用技巧

时间2025-09-27 17:57:03发布访客分类主机资讯浏览892
导读:JDK命令行工具是Java开发者日常开发中不可或缺的一部分,它们可以帮助开发者监控Java应用程序的性能、分析内存使用情况、进行垃圾回收等。以下是一些JDK命令的使用技巧和优化方法: 常用JDK命令 jps:列出所有Java进程的进程ID...

JDK命令行工具是Java开发者日常开发中不可或缺的一部分,它们可以帮助开发者监控Java应用程序的性能、分析内存使用情况、进行垃圾回收等。以下是一些JDK命令的使用技巧和优化方法:

常用JDK命令

  • jps:列出所有Java进程的进程ID和主类名,是排查Java进程启动问题的首选工具。
  • jstat:监控Java虚拟机的性能指标,如类加载、垃圾回收活动等,有助于性能调优。
  • jinfo:查看正在运行的Java虚拟机的配置信息,支持在运行时动态调整部分参数。
  • jmap:生成Java堆转储快照,用于分析内存泄漏或调优内存设置。
  • jhat:分析Java堆转储文件,生成堆转储报告,可通过浏览器查看。

性能优化技巧

  • 调整堆空间大小:通过设置-Xms(初始堆大小)和-Xmx(最大堆大小)来优化内存分配。
  • 垃圾回收机制:调整年轻代和老年代的比例(-XX:NewRatio),启用并行垃圾回收(-XX:+UseParallelGC)等,以提高垃圾回收效率。
  • 压缩指针优化:对于32位JVM,开启压缩指针(-XX:+UseCompressedOops)可以提高内存利用率。

使用JDK命令的注意事项

  • 在使用JDK命令时,注意查看命令的输出信息,以便更好地理解Java虚拟机的运行状态和性能指标。
  • 对于复杂的性能调优问题,建议结合使用多个命令和工具,进行综合分析和优化。

通过掌握这些JDK命令的使用技巧和性能优化方法,开发者可以更加高效地进行Java应用程序的开发和维护工作。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: jdk命令 使用技巧
本文地址: https://pptw.com/jishu/710283.html
jdk命令 有哪些优化 jdk命令 如何调试

游客 回复需填写必要信息